Cheapest Available Williams Apartments for Rent

 

The cheapest available apartment rental in the Williams area of Charlotte, NC is a 1 Bed unit found at Nottingham Apartments priced from $885. Sunset Apartments has the second lowest priced unit, which is a 1 Bed apartment currently listed from $1,100. Here are the most affordable Williams apartments for rent in Charlotte, NC:

Apartment ListingModel NameBed/BathPriced From
Nottingham Apartments1 Bedroom 1 Bath1BR,1BA$885
Sunset Apartments1 Bedroom 1 Bath1BR,1BA$1,100
Village Square ApartmentsThe Riverstone2BR,1BA$1,175
Piedmont LoftsStudio1BR,1BA$1,300
Woodbrook Apartment HomesTwo Bedroom 2 Bath2BR,2BA$1,340

Frequently Asked Questions about Cheap Williams Apartments

How much is rent for a Cheap One Bedroom Williams Apartment?

The lowest price for a Cheap One Bedroom Williams Apartment is $885 at Nottingham Apartments.

What is the lowest price for a Cheap Two Bedroom Williams Apartment for rent?

Today's best deal for a Cheap Two Bedroom Apartment in Williams is starting from $1,175 at Village Square Apartments.
